About this job

What you will do   

The Life Safety Preventive Service Sales role is critical to the overall growth and profitability of the business! The chosen candidate will promote and sell service agreements (Preventative Maintenance Agreements) for commercial building systems including, fire alarm, suppression, sprinkler, security, sound, communication and inspection.
